Paul, Could you elaborate with regard to how you modified the u-boot parameters or point me in the right direction. I am getting the following error when booting: CMEM Range Overlaps Kernel Physical - allowing overlap CMEM phys_start (0x86300000) overlaps kernel (0x80000000 -> 0x90000000) CMEMK Error: Failed to request_mem_region(0x86300000, 16777216) FATAL: Error inserting cmemk (/lib/modules/2.6.32/kernel/drivers/dsp/cmemk.ko): Bad address and need to direct the boot loader to free up this region for CMEM.
